RF Engineer (Mid-Level)

Leidos is seeking a Mid-Level Radio Frequency (RF) Engineer to support our customer in advancing its research and development mission. This role involves hands-on technical exploration across concept development, technology assessment, experimentation, analysis, documentation, integration, and transition of emerging capabilities.

Responsibilities

Design and execute experiments evaluating the effects of RF signals on various materials. This may involve developing mathematical models, simulation inputs, or collaborating with others to replicate or adjust signal characteristics
Develop, refine, and employ prototype tools for signal generation, measurement, observation, and optimization
Analyze and summarize key findings and present results to government customers and technical teams
Review and assess external research, theories, and concepts; prepare summaries and recommendations for the government technical team
Identify, design, adapt, demonstrate, and evaluate specialized tools for generating, transmitting, and measuring signals and associated effects
Document procedures, protocols, and best practices; develop troubleshooting guides and standard operating procedures to ensure repeatability and consistency in testing and experimentation
